Troubleshooting Problem Procedure The battery depletes quickly even when I have turned OFF the power of the computer When USB Sleep and Charge function is set to [Enabled] in the HW Setup, USB bus power (DC5V) will be supplied to the external device connected to the compatible port. If external device is connected to the compatible port when the AC adaptor is not connected to the computer, the battery of the computer will be depleted even when the power of the computer is turned OFF. Connect the AC adaptor to the computer or change the USB Sleep and Charge function setting the [Disabled] in the HW Setup. Instead use a USB Port does not have the USB Sleep and Charge function-compatible icon ( ). The USB WakeUp function does not work When USB Sleep and Charge function is set to [Enabled] in the HW Setup, the USB WakeUp function does not work for ports that support the USB Sleep and Charge function. In that case, use an USB port that does not have the USB Sleep and Charge function-compatible icon ( ) or change the USB Sleep and Charge function setting to [Disabled ] in the HW Setup. eSATA/USB combo port Refer also to your eSATA device and USB device's documentation.
